Transaction 65c3543178f471af92384e21b9e396f2796a38c09b462961502daeeddaf53e2a

1 Input
2 Outputs
  • 65c3543178f471af92384e21b9e396f2796a38c09b462961502daeeddaf53e2a:0
  • value  625279396
    address  1GfE4pHYM7p4Rgfn4AVudogWm9DqZ4o7Eu
  • 65c3543178f471af92384e21b9e396f2796a38c09b462961502daeeddaf53e2a:1
  • value  1601913
    address  12pPEPcrrtqzdMm883aH3fxhunbHdiwXEk